I finally received a Beta invite to Diablo III however tonight's server maintenance for Battle.net means I can't play tonight so instead I thought I'd share how to extract the music from MPQ files for Diablo III. My initial interest is of course listening to the awesome music composed by Russell Brower who has from what I've heard thus far has been able to really honor some of the Wagnerian style music Diablo II fans are familiar with from Act V. While I'll have a copy of the soundtrack when I purchase the Diablo III Collector's Edition generally the problem with scores (which are very commonly incorrectly referred to as soundtracks) is that they are incomplete if they are even released.
To extract the music from Diablo III Beta you first obviously need a copy of the Diablo III beta and secondly you need a copy of WinMPQ by ShadowFlare. When you have WinMPQ the quickest way to find the music is to use the filter *ogg or *.ogg which then removes all the other file types. Keep in mind that these files range in the several hundred megabyte range and seem to contain a few hundred if not a couple thousand files each; my Phenom II processor opened the largest files in a little less than half a minute. There are two MPQ files that the music can be found in at the time of this blog post. The first is the more obvious, Diablo III Beta\Data_D3\PC\MPQs\Sound.mpq with an internal path of SoundBank\Music\ and other secondary directories with names that start with music. The second and much less obvious file is Diablo III Beta\Data_D3\PC\MPQs\base\d3-update-base-7728.MPQ with an internal path of \SoundBank\Music_Actx_TitleCredits and again there are other secondary directories with names that start with music.
